TV ratings: 'The Big Bang Theory' and 'Scandal' hit series highs yet again Thursday
Fast National ratings for Thursday, Jan. 10, 2013Ho-hum -- another Thursday, another series-best performance for "The Big Bang Theory."
The CBS comedy scored nearly 20 million viewers and posted a 6.3 rating among adults 18-49 in leading the network to a big ratings win for the night. "Scandal" also continued its second-season surge on ABC, scoring series highs in viewers and the 18-49 demo.
On a smaller scale, NBC's comedies were also up a little bit. The Critics' Choice Movie Awards put up decent numbers for The CW.
CBS averaged 14.65 million viewers and a 9.0 rating/14 share in households for the night. ABC (7.8 million, 5.1/8) finished a distant second. NBC (3.9 million, 2.6/4) came in third, followed by FOX (2.65 million, 1.7/3). The CW trailed with 1.9 million viewers and a 1.4/2.
CBS also won the adults 18-49 demographic with a 3.6 rating. ABC (2.4) was the only other network to get above the 2.0 mark. NBC was third at 1.5, followed by FOX, 0.9, and The CW, 0.6.
Thursday hour by hour:
8 p.m.
CBS: "The Big Bang Theory" (19.8 million viewers, 11.8/19 households)/"Two and a Half Men" (14.3 million, 8.8/14)
ABC: "Last Resort" (5.8 million, 3.7/6)
NBC: "30 Rock" (3.8 million, 2.5/4)/"1600 Penn" rerun (3.9 million, 2.5/4)
FOX: "Mobbed" (3.3 million, 2.1/3)
The CW: Critics Choice Movie Awards (1.9 million, 1.4/2)
18-49 leader: "The Big Bang Theory" (6.3)
9 p.m.
CBS: "Person of Interest" (15.6 million, 9.5/15)
ABC: "Grey's Anatomy" (9.2 million, 6.0/9)
NBC: "The Office" (4.5 million, 2.8/4)/"1600 Penn" (3.85 million, 2.4/4)
FOX: "Glee" rerun (2 million, 1.3/2)
The CW: Critics Choice Movie Awards (1.9 million, 1.4/2)
18-49 leader: "Person of Interest" (3.3)
10 p.m.
CBS: "Elementary" (11.3 million, 7.2/12)
ABC: "Scandal" (8.4 million, 5.6/9)
NBC: "Rock Center with Brian Williams" (3.8 million, 2.6/4)
18-49 leader: "Scandal" (2.8)
Ratings information includes live and same-day DVR viewing. All numbers are preliminary and subject to change. Source: The Nielsen Company.
